Learn more about Marloth Park
Wild giraffes and zebras wander freely past vacation rentals in this unique wildlife sanctuary bordering Kruger National Park. Book a guided safari drive through Kruger or enjoy sundowners on your porch while warthogs and impalas visit your garden.

Best time to go to Marloth Park
The best time to visit Marloth Park is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. February is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ain.
Calendar Month | Temperature | Precipitation | Cloudiness | Occupancy | Pricing |
| January | 75.4°F (24.1°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Average | Slightly High |
| February | 75.6°F (24.2°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Slightly Low | Average |
| March | 74.5°F (23.6°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ny | Average | Slightly High |
| April | 70.3°F (21.3°C) | No Rain | Mostly Sunny | Slightly High | Average |
| May | 67.1°F (19.5°C) | No Rain | Sunny | Slightly Low | Slightly High |
| June | 62.4°F (16.9°C) | No Rain | Sunny | Average | Slightly Low |
| July | 62.1°F (16.7°C) | No Rain | Sunny | Slightly High | Average |
| August | 66.0°F (18.9°C) | No Rain | Sunny | Average | Slightly Low |
| September | 70.7°F (21.5°C) | No Rain | Mostly Sunny | Slightly High | Average |
| October | 72.3°F (22.4°C) | No Rain | Mostly Sunny | Average | Slightly Low |
| November | 74.1°F (23.4°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ny | Slightly Low | Average |
| December | 75.4°F (24.1°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Average | Average |
The nearest major airports for your trip to Marloth Park
Traveling to Marloth Park is convenient with several nearby airports. Hoedspruit (HDS), 82 miles away, offers luxurious stays at Kapama River Lodge, AM Lodge, and Kapama Southern Camp, all providing various transportation services including 24-hour airport shuttles. Nelspruit (MQP-Kruger Mpumalanga Intl.), located 42 miles away, features Nut Grove Boutique Hotel, Francolin Lodge, and Loerie's Call Guesthouse, which offer airport shuttles on request and other transportation options. Skukuza (SZK) is the closest at 30 miles and has Lion Sands River Lodge, Lion Sands Tinga Lodge, and Lion Sands Narina Lodge, all providing complimentary shuttle services for guests. Each airport ensures a smooth travel experience to Marloth Park.
